Jcon 04-03-2004 06:35 AM

I have a set of SSI' s from my 3.0. I just bought a low mileage 92 3.6. Can I use my existing SSIs with this with slight "hammereing". I know bill posted that's what he did, but is it different for a 964 engine vs a 993?

Jeff C

Bill Verburg 04-03-2004 10:14 AM

Yes, it is different for a 993. The 993 has the passenger side studs oriented in the wrong directionfor SSI flanges. This is not a big issue as the 993 heads are predrilled for the correct stud positions.
